Quiz Answer Key and Fun Facts
1. On the night that the infection broke loose, Joel lost his daughter, Sarah. Was she killed by the infection?

Answer: No

The game's prologue takes place in Texas and in this you partly take control of Sarah, at least until everything hits the fan on the fateful night that the outbreak escalates. After Joel gets home from work and Sarah goes to bed, Sarah is awakened by explosions and chaos in the distance; Joel is attacked by the neighbour before the two hop into Tommy's truck and attempt to leave their Texas town.

It's during this escape that Sarah is killed. Though Joel and Sarah are able to run from danger, they find themselves spotted out by a military man with a gun, ordered to shoot on sight. He'll fire at Sarah, hitting her in the stomach, before he's taken out himself. There's nothing Joel and Tommy will be able to do but watch as Sarah bleeds out.
2. Ellie, as it is discovered, is infected by a bite on which part of her body?

Answer: Arm

Once Ellie is handed off to Joel and Tess to be taken out of the Boston Quarantine Zone, it's a short amount of time before they're all caught out by the military, and it's during a quick scan that it's discovered the Ellie is harbouring a problematic secret, specifically that she was bit several weeks earlier and has yet to turn. It's because of this injury that she's so valuable; it indicates her immunity to the Cordyceps infection.

The remainder of the game, for the most part, involves attempting to deliver Ellie to the Fireflies, wherever they end up finding them, in an effort to synthesize a cure, but this comes at its own cost.
3. In the Boston Quarantine Zone, Tess is which of the following?

Answer: Smuggler

Years after the Cordyceps infection spread, the survivors had to reconsolidate, forming small communities and quarantine zones around the United States in order to protect themselves from dangers of all sorts. In Boston, Joel works alongside Ellie, a smuggler, for a number of smaller jobs, and finds success hacking it with his resourcefulness.

It's the resourcefulness that makes both Joel and Tess important to Marlene, the leader of the Fireflies, who requests that the pair smuggle Ellie safely out of the Boston Quarantine Zone. It's during this effort to escape the Boston area that Tess is bitten by an infected and sacrifices herself against the military to give the others a bit of time and distance. It's because of this sacrifice that Joel and Ellie are able to escape into the nearby town of Lincoln and continue their journey west.
4. The leader of the Fireflies, Marlene, asks Joel and Tess to get Ellie out of the Boston Quarantine Zone. Where does Joel encounter Marlene again?

Answer: Salt Lake City

Marlene already has a reputation when Joel and Tess encounter her in the Boston Quarantine Zone. The problem, however, is that the Fireflies are revolting against the military there, so while Marlene handles the problem at hand, in a roundabout way she employs the smugglers to get Ellie out of the city, aiming to put her in the hands of her scientists. She ultimately isn't forthcoming about Ellie's unique circumstances.

Marlene is met once more in Salt Lake City when Joel and Ellie finally make it to their destination. Unfortunately, by this point, Joel has a much more significant relationship with the girl and will find himself unwilling to put her at risk to find the cure. It'll mean killing Marlene, who stands in their way, to get away from the Fireflies and to safety.
5. In Lincoln, Joel and Ellie seek out Bill in an effort to secure which of these?

Answer: A vehicle

As soon as Joel and Ellie make it out of the Boston Quarantine Zone and the surrounding area, Joel will beeline for the town of Lincoln, where the surly and paranoid prepper, Bill, will owe him a favour or two. Their trip there will be a fraught with not only infected hordes, but traps, all laid out by Bill, to keep unwanted people and creatures out. Nonetheless, they'll get to him.

Joel and Ellie's trip with Bill may be short and argumentative, but they will end up crossing Lincoln as a trio, fighting larger and larger foes, to inevitably find a working vehicle that they can ride all the way out to Pittsburgh. As soon as he can hand off the vehicle, Bill will consider his debt with Joel repaid and turn for home, never to be seen again.
6. Which of these is true about Sam?

Answer: He's younger than Henry

Joel and Ellie will encounter brothers Sam and Henry when they pass through Pittsburgh, effortfully avoiding the bandits out for blood, and though Sam will be apprehensive about working with the pair, it'll turn out that they're all headed the same direction-- out of the city to a meet-up point to head onward to the Fireflies.

Henry, the older of the two brothers, will be extremely cautious of the danger that he and his brother are in, but he'll open up when it appears that Ellie and Joel are not only good resources, but safer to be around. The four of them will cross through the sewers outside Waverly Township together. The problem is that their time in Waverly will be marred by an encounter that leaves Sam infected, and he'll keep this hidden until it's too late.
7. A pivotal night in the suburbs of Pittsburgh spells Henry's end by which means?

Answer: Suicide

Once it's revealed that Sam has been infected by a Clicker during the group's rush through Waverly Township, it'll be too late; the group will wake up after a morning in a local safehouse and he'll attack Ellie. It'll force Henry to make a split-second decision to put his brother out of his misery, and only moments after that, he'll turn the gun on himself, unable to cope with what he's been pushed to do.

With that, Joel and Ellie will need to proceed to Jackson on their own.
8. When Joel encounters his brother, Tommy, outside of Jackson, he discovers that he's married to whom?

Answer: Maria

Tommy, Joel's brother, first appears in the game's prologue, showing up as an escape plan once the infected start attacking. It's fortunate that he'll end up surviving over the years, first being an active figure during Marlene's rise in the Fireflies, but eventually making a home for himself out in Jackson, Wyoming, settling down with his new wife, Maria.

Joel will encounter Tommy again when he and Ellie make it out to Jackson and his intent will be to hand Ellie off so that they can take the rest of the route to the Fireflies' encampment. Naturally, Joel ends up taking her the rest of the way himself, partly because he has a change of heart, but partly because Tommy appears to be settling down to raise a family.
9. Ellie's final encounter with David has her facing him down in which location?

Answer: Restaurant

After a pivotal encounter with bandits on the University of Eastern Colorado campus, Joel will be severely injured and Ellie will stow him away in the basement of a resort lodge elsewhere in the state, hoping to ride out the winter and his ailments. This will lead her to have to be self-sufficient, and she'll do this well until she encounters David and his group of survivors who, after providing her antibiotics, will pursue her in an effort to bolster their food supply. Yes-- it'll turn out they're cannibals.

It becomes more of a problem after David discovers Ellie is infected, against all logic, and she'll make an escape attempt. This will culminate in a fight in a restaurant dining room where she'll need to use all her strength to, violently, take out David with his own machete. Joel will find her there in the ruins of a burning building.
10. Although she alludes to Riley at the end of the story, Ellie notes that she was who of the following, to her?

Answer: Her best friend

Riley never appears during the main story of "The Last of Us Part I", but she is a key figure in the "Left Behind" DLC, which shows how Ellie got infected. The two, best friends, would find themselves in a bind in a mall near the Boston Quarantine Zone when they encountered the infected and both wound up injured by the creatures. Both, instead of opting for suicide, decided to hold out and spend as much time as possible together before turning.

While Riley turned, Ellie never did.
